The press turned out in full last night to visit the new flagship essie salon, located within the freshly remodeled Samuel Shriqui Salon on East 65th Street on Manhattan's Upper East Side.

The space, designed by architect Peter Millard, features a recessed white wall which dramatically displays every single essie shade...that's 250! Clients look at these shades from love seats matched to different classic essie shades including Bahama Mama, Coral Reef, Raisinnuts, Big Spender and Status Symbol.

Ad Loading...

In this video, Essie introduces us to Josephine Allen, her manicurist of 25 years. Josephine has been the lead manicurist at the salon and will now head the new essie space.

"I feel like I'm 'Queen for a Day' everytime I come here," says Essie about the Samuel Shriqui Salon which she has been visiting weekly for the past 25 years. "Josephine is the ultimate professional. She can get everything done in less than 45 minutes, including doing your nails while your hair is blown out."

What are the challenges working with Essie? Says Josephine, "We talk about colors and techniques, but she allows me to select shape and sometimes the colors."

"She does amazing combos," says Essie. "I just let her do whatever she wants. It's a wonderful relationship."
